Halloween-Masked Bandit Robs Bank in Choconut Twp. Pennsylvania State Police report an armed man wearing a Halloween mask robbed the Penn Star Bank on Rt. 267 in Choconut Twp, Susquehanna Co. at 5:35 Friday evening. The man approached the teller, displayed a pistol, and demanded that his bag be filled with cash. He left with an undisclosed amount of money.
